
137: The Unconventional Way to Feel Equity at Work For Childless Women
03/09/25 • 64 min
If you're frustrated with workplace structures, experiencing inequities, or feeling envy towards mothers or other women - this episode is for you. This is Part 2 of a discussion I had with my sister, Jen, about women in the workplace and the experiences of both mothers and childless women.
This episode might ruffle some feathers. Jen and I are going to lay out why the diversity, equity, and inclusion initiatives (or dismantling of them right now in the US) might not matter.
Then, we suggest some new and unconventional ways to find equity in the workplace for women in general, and specifically, how to bridge the gap between mothers and non-mothers.
We cover so much in this episode. Things like:
- empowering you to find a feeling of equity internally
- how to stop trying to fit into a man's world and own your feminine strengths
- how to stop being agreeable and playing small
We believe that the more women lead authentically, the more the system will have no choice but to adapt. Listen in if you want to be your authentic, joyful, childless self.
